Understanding Breast Lift Surgery
Before exploring the top hospitals, it's crucial to understand the basics of breast lift surgery. Breast lift is a surgical procedure aimed at raising and reshaping sagging breasts. The process involves removing excess skin and tightening the surrounding tissue to support and contour a new, rejuvenated breast profile.
Reasons for Breast Sagging
- Aging: As women age, the natural production of collagen and elastin in the skin decreases. This reduction leads to a loss of firmness and elasticity in the breast tissues, causing them to droop.
- Pregnancy and Breastfeeding: During pregnancy, the breasts enlarge and become heavier. After breastfeeding, the milk glands return to their normal size, but the skin may remain stretched, resulting in sagging.
- Weight Changes: Significant weight gain can stretch the skin, and after weight loss, the skin may not shrink back, leading to sagging breasts.
- Gravity: Over time, the constant downward pull of gravity on the breast tissues can cause them to sag.
Types of Breast Lift Procedures
Procedure Type | Description | Best Suited For |
---|---|---|
Crescent Lift | A small incision is made around the top half of the areola. It's a less invasive procedure. | Patients looking to slightly lift the breasts. |
Circumareolar Lift (Donut Lift) | An incision is made around the entire areola. It can raise sagging breast tissue. | Mild breast sagging and can also reduce the size of the areola. |
Lollipop Lift (Vertical Lift) | An initial incision is made around the areola, followed by a second incision from the bottom of the areola to the crease of the breast. | Moderate breast sagging, allowing for a moderate lift and repositioning of the breasts. |
Anchor Lift (Inverted - T Lift) | Three incisions are made: one around the areola, another from the base of the areola to the crease of the breast, and a final incision along the crease of the breast. | Severe breast sagging, providing the most dramatic results with more tissue tightening and repositioning. |

Factors to Consider When Choosing a Hospital for Breast Lift Surgery
Surgeon's Experience and Expertise
The skill and experience of the surgeon are of utmost importance. Look for surgeons who are board - certified and have extensive experience in performing breast lift surgeries. Surgeons with a proven track record of successful procedures are more likely to provide satisfactory results. Check their credentials, the number of years they have been practicing, and any awards or recognition they have received.
Hospital Facilities and Accreditation
Choose a hospital or surgical facility that is fully accredited. Accreditation ensures that the facility meets high - quality standards for patient safety, hygiene, and equipment. Modern and well - equipped facilities can enhance the surgical experience and improve the chances of a successful outcome. The presence of advanced monitoring equipment and a clean and comfortable operating environment are also important factors.
Patient Reviews and Testimonials
Reading patient reviews and testimonials can give you an insight into the patient experience at a particular hospital or with a specific surgeon. Look for reviews that mention the quality of care, communication with the medical staff, and the final results of the breast lift surgery. Positive reviews from real patients can increase your confidence in the choice of hospital and surgeon.
Cost and Financing Options
The cost of breast lift surgery can vary depending on factors such as the surgeon's fees, the complexity of the procedure, and the location of the hospital. It's important to get a clear estimate of the total cost before the surgery. Some hospitals offer financing options to help patients manage the cost. Make sure to understand the payment terms and any additional costs that may be involved.
Aftercare and Follow - up
Good aftercare is crucial for a successful recovery. The hospital or surgeon should provide detailed instructions on wound care, pain management, and activity restrictions. They should also schedule regular follow - up appointments to monitor the healing process and address any concerns that may arise. Accessible and responsive medical staff during the recovery period can make a significant difference in the patient's experience.
Risks and Complications of Breast Lift Surgery
While breast lift surgery is generally considered safe, like any surgical procedure, it carries some risks. It's important for patients to be aware of these risks before deciding to undergo the surgery.
Common Risks
- Infection: There is a risk of infection at the incision site. This can usually be managed with antibiotics, but in severe cases, it may require additional treatment.
- Bleeding: Some bleeding may occur during or after the surgery. In most cases, it can be controlled, but in rare cases, it may require a second procedure to stop the bleeding.
- Scarring: All breast lift surgeries result in some degree of scarring. The location and visibility of the scars depend on the type of incision used. Surgeons take measures to minimize scarring, but the appearance of scars can vary from patient to patient.
- Changes in Nipple Sensation: Some patients may experience temporary or permanent changes in nipple sensation. This can range from decreased sensitivity to complete loss of sensation.
- Asymmetry: There may be a slight difference in the shape or position of the two breasts after the surgery. In some cases, a revision surgery may be required to correct the asymmetry.
Reducing Risks
To reduce the risks of breast lift surgery, patients should choose a qualified and experienced surgeon, follow all preoperative and postoperative instructions carefully, and disclose their full medical history to the surgeon. It's also important to quit smoking before the surgery, as smoking can impair healing and increase the risk of complications.
